National Symphony Orchestra in Danger: Ben Folds Speaks Out (2026)

Ben Folds, the renowned pianist and alt-rock artist, has issued a stark warning about the future of the National Symphony Orchestra (NSO) amidst the ongoing chaos at the Kennedy Center. In a recent social media post, Folds, who resigned from his role as artistic advisor to the NSO last year, expressed deep concern about the orchestra's dire situation.

Folds' open letter to fans paints a grim picture of the NSO's current predicament. He asserts that the orchestra is 'in real trouble' and may not survive the ongoing turmoil at the Kennedy Center. The center has been at the center of controversy due to President Donald Trump's efforts to have the venue named after him, which has led to a federal judge ordering the removal of Trump's name and halting the planned two-year closure for renovations.

The NSO's future appears uncertain, with no programming announced for the upcoming season. Folds highlights the stark contrast between the NSO's situation and other orchestras, which have already announced their plans for the next 18 months. This lack of clarity and planning has raised concerns about the orchestra's ability to continue its operations.

Folds calls on orchestral music enthusiasts to take action. He urges fans to voice their support for the NSO on public forums and to contact their members of Congress, demanding safeguards to prevent similar issues from occurring at other federal arts institutions. The pianist emphasizes the power of public support in turning the tide for the NSO.

The situation at the Kennedy Center has also affected ticket sales and the presence of big-name acts. Folds criticizes the leadership of the Kennedy Center during Trump's second term, suggesting that the center's operations have been mishandled. He argues that the center's director should have relevant experience in arts administration, a point that reflects his broader concerns about the organization's stability.
